Quality Technician
The purpose of the Quality Laboratory Technician is to protect customers from non-quality by ensuring that products and practices comply with applicable regulations, customer requirements, and Kennametal standards, and by promoting a culture of prevention and anticipation.
The Quality Technician is responsible for performing laboratory tests and inspections to ensure that raw materials, in-process samples, and finished products meet established quality standards. This role involves maintaining accurate documentation, calibrating lab equipment, and supporting compliance with regulatory and company requirements. Cross-functional collaboration will be required between quality control, quality assurance, labeling, and packing.
Key Job Responsibilities
* Conduct chemical and mechanical testing of all raw materials, intermediate, in-process materials, and finished products in accordance with established protocols and procedures.
* Conduct visual and dimensional inspections of all raw materials, intermediate, in-process materials, and finished products where applicable.
* Maintain sample traceability and proper documentation in LIMS or other systems to ensure data integrity, regulatory compliance, and operational efficiency in laboratory settings. Maintain all documentation, data, and record-keeping.
* Monitor and replenish stock reagents and consumables. Carry out material transactions using SAP.
* Calibrate, maintain, and troubleshoot laboratory equipment and instruments to ensure accuracy and reliability of results.
* Analyse data and report on trends; use this data to propose changes or improvements to the current process.
* Drive continuous improvement by leveraging factual data and feedback and providing support for all company functions.
* Assist as a team member in problem-solving activities for manufacturing product quality issues and measures.
* Participate in laboratory meetings, trainings, and professional development activities to stay updated on industry trends and best practices.
* Ensure 5S standards are maintained in the laboratory and office areas; undertake housekeeping tasks, maintain and repair equipment, and participate in ISO audits when required.
* Liaise with the Quality Manager regarding occurrences likely to cause a breakdown or disruption in the laboratory activities.
* Adhere to all GMP and safety standards in the laboratory setting; some PPE (safety glasses, gloves, etc.) is required.
